One of the particularly significant threats during exploitation is the climatic threat, which is associated with an increase in the overall costs that are allocated to combating it. The rise in the virgin temperature of the rock mass by 1oC increases the demand for the required cooling capacity to be taken from the air. The publication assesses the effectiveness of the air-conditioning installation by testing its operation on a selected example. The assessment of the efficiency of the air-conditioning installation for a selected hard coal mine showed that none of the five tested coolers achieved the maximum assumed rated power. The use of total power (7.5 MW) in mining excavations was less than 50% and amounted to η = 0.472%. The research showed that the main reason for obtaining low cooling parameters is the inability to locate them in the place of the highest air temperatures. The other problem is an insufficient airflow rate of cooling water supplied to the coolers at too high temperature. The above considerations indicated that the cooling power from built-in air- conditioning systems is not properly and effectively used. Improving the efficiency of its functioning is possible by proceeding research that will eliminate the above factors and by using air conditioning equipment, taking into account the periodic audit of their work to reduce electricity consumption.

Wycofana norma PN-EN ISO 13790 została zastąpiona normą PN-EN ISO 52016, która określa wiele metod obliczeniowych zapotrzebowania na energię budynków do ich ogrzewania, chłodzenia, nawilżania i odwilżania powietrza wewnętrznego, obliczania bilansu energii i wyznaczania temperatury wewnętrznej w budynkach oraz wyznaczania zapotrzebowania na moc ogrzewania i chłodzenia. W artykule opisano metody obliczeniowe zawarte w tej normie oraz omówiono związki pomiędzy tą normą i normą PN-EN ISO 52017 oraz innymi powołanymi normami. W artykule przedstawiono również różnice metod obliczeniowych wycofanej normy PN-EN ISO 13790 i normy omawianej w artykule.

The with drawn PN-EN ISO 13790 standard has been replaced by the PN-EN ISO 52016 standard, which contains a number of calculation methods for energy demand of buildings for heating, cooling, humidifying and dehumidifying indoor air, calculating the energy balance and determining the indoor temperature in buildings and determining the heating and cooling loads. The article describes the calculation methods contained in this standard and discusses the relationship between this standard and the PN-EN ISO 52017 standard and other referenced standards. The article also presents the differences in the calculation methods of the withdrawn PN-EN ISO 13790 standard and the standard discussed in this work.
